The Q-TRAN Wide Linear Fixtures can be mounted using different methods, depending on your preference and the specific installation requirements. Here are the three mounting options provided by Q-Tran:
1. xxxx Mounting: This method involves using screws to secure the fixture in place. You will need to use the provided stainless steel clips (SST-09) or plastic clips (PLC-03) to attach the fixture to the desired surface. For fixtures that are 4 feet or less in length, two clips are provided, while fixtures longer than 4 feet come with four clips.
2. 832 Silicone Mounting: Q-Tran recommends using 832 Silicone for mounting the fixtures. This silicone should be used in a well-ventilated area and is sold with a caulking gun. It is important to note that the 832 Silicone should not be used in any submersible applications.
3. VHB Mounting: VHB (Very High Bond) is another mounting option provided by Q-Tran. VHB tape is a strong adhesive tape that can securely attach the fixture to the desired surface. This method offers a clean and easy installation process.
It is crucial to follow Q-Tran's installation methods when making any field modifications to the fixtures. Failure to do so may void the warranty. For more detailed instructions and guidelines, please refer to the Q-TRAN Wide Linear Fixtures Installation Guide provided by Q-Tran Inc.
